Pvt William Pitchford Stone CO. "C" 28th Alabama Infantry 1844 - 1938 William P. Stone was born 4th of May 1844 to Wiley and Candice Buckner Stone in the shadow of Stone Mountain, approximately 15 miles east of Atlanta. On 4th Feb 1862 at age 19 William P. Stone became a private in Capt. Maxmillian Tidmore's Company. William was twice wounded, once at Murfreesboro & then at Chicamauga. The regiment surrendered at Greenesborough, North Carolina.
